(PRWeb) March 18, 2007 -- Full Mental Jacket, led by designer/manager Ronen Lasry has completed set design and production on Bill Nye Inventions for the Discovery Education Channel. The show, produced by Karen Carlson for Tapestry International, is intended to continue Bill Nye's stock in trade, the child-friendly science lesson with a lot of humor thrown in to keep the little ones interested.
The set, inspired by the look of genre sci-fi pulp magazines of the 40s and 50s, was built in a little over a week to meet Tapestry's very tight production schedule. "The whole project was pretty ambitious. Tapestry had little creative direction from their client and we worked together to come up with something inventive in a very short amount of time. Our ultimate idea was elaborate, creating a set that was more a character in and of itself than mere backdrop for the action."
Los Angeles based Full Mental Jacket is the world's leading design firm focused on creating high-end real time virtual sets and graphics for broadcast entertainment and corporate simulation and training.
